Phoenix Police arrest 1 in store robbery
Oct 8, 2012, 7:10 AM | Updated: 10:23 am
PHOENIX — One suspect is in police custody while another remains at large, after an early-morning robbery at a west-side convenience store.
According to Phoenix Police, two armed men robbed the Circle K store at 23rd Avenue and Bethany Home Road, taking cash and cigarettes before tying up the clerk and leaving.
The suspects fled in an SUV. The erratic driving attracted the attention of an officer, who began pursuit. The suspects ended up in a cul-de-sac, where they fled the scene on foot.
Police blocked off several streets in the area of 23rd and Orangewood avenues. One suspect was captured in an apartment.
The clerk was unharmed.
